Hi, after updating xmonad on my OpenBSD machine from 0.7 to 0.9.1 (built with ghc-6.12.2-rc1), I noticed that xmonad now leaves zombie processes around, i.e. it doesn't properly wait(2) for its terminated child processes. This happens for every single launched (and later terminated) xterm as well as for every launch of dmenu. Does anyone else see this problem? Ciao, Kili
